diff options
Diffstat (limited to 'tests/qemu-iotests')
-rw-r--r-- | tests/qemu-iotests/common.config | 12 |
1 files changed, 9 insertions, 3 deletions
diff --git a/tests/qemu-iotests/common.config b/tests/qemu-iotests/common.config index d5a72affc6..d07f435696 100644 --- a/tests/qemu-iotests/common.config +++ b/tests/qemu-iotests/common.config @@ -87,13 +87,19 @@ export BC_PROG="`set_prog_path bc`" export PS_ALL_FLAGS="-ef" -export QEMU_PROG="`set_prog_path qemu`" +if [ -z "$QEMU_PROG" ]; then + export QEMU_PROG="`set_prog_path qemu`" +fi [ "$QEMU_PROG" = "" ] && _fatal "qemu not found" -export QEMU_IMG_PROG="`set_prog_path qemu-img`" +if [ -z "$QEMU_IMG_PROG" ]; then + export QEMU_IMG_PROG="`set_prog_path qemu-img`" +fi [ "$QEMU_IMG_PROG" = "" ] && _fatal "qemu-img not found" -export QEMU_IO_PROG="`set_prog_path qemu-io`" +if [ -z "$QEMU_IO_PROG" ]; then + export QEMU_IO_PROG="`set_prog_path qemu-io`" +fi [ "$QEMU_IO_PROG" = "" ] && _fatal "qemu-io not found" export QEMU=$QEMU_PROG |